• 18.0 mi ride - Encinitas - Friday, September 5, 2025
    Logged this ride 51 minutes ago
  • 14.0 mi ride - Wednesday, September 3, 2025
    Logged this ride 2 days ago
  • 13.0 mi ride - We are off and riding - Tuesday, September 2, 2025

    From Peloton

    Logged this ride 3 days ago